Me again, * Ralf Wildenhues wrote on Tue, Nov 08, 2005 at 05:04:42PM CET: > * Dave Benson wrote on Tue, Nov 08, 2005 at 04:31:21PM CET: > > > > I've been porting some software to freebsd 5.4, > > and i've been encountering an issue in the > > precedence of LD_LIBRARY_PATH versus -rpath. > > > > Apparently, linux and older version of freebsd > > treat -rpath to be of higher precedence. > > The newest freebsds treat LD_LIBRARY_PATH > > as having higher precedence. (apparently solaris > > also has LD_LIBRARY_PATH higher precendence)
> I am working on a related fix at the moment. > Give me a little bit time, it should be fixed in 1.5.22. > I can notify you when I have something to test. OK, this PR: http://www.freebsd.org/cgi/query-pr.cgi?pr=28191 | | State-Changed-When: Sun Feb 10 17:12:40 PST 2002 | State-Changed-Why: | The fix for this has been merged into the RELENG_4 branch. suggests that the change (to give LD_LIBRARY_PATH highest precedence) was in version 4.6 (which came out June 2002). Can anybody confirm this? Also, I don't know when they stopped using freebsdelf as a name, so I'm just guessing from version 4 maybe? Dave, could you try this patch on CVS branch-1-5 Libtool? (there is another related fix in the branch, newer than 1.5.20) Thanks, Ralf * libtool.m4 (AC_LIBTOOL_SYS_DYNAMIC_LINKER) [ freebsd ]: Fix shlibpath_overrides_runpath settings.
